Speech by Piero Cipollone, Member of the Executive Board of the ECB, at a workshop on digital assets and monetary policy transmission organised by the European Central Bank, Banca d’Italia, the Euro Area Business Cycle Network and the Centre for Economic Policy Research

Rome, 4 May 2026

Digitalisation and tokenisation are transforming payments and finance.[1]

These innovations have the potential to improve financial services and reduce costs; they also have important implications that central banks need to consider.

Today I will therefore outline how a central bank should position itself to genuinely help enhance the economic efficiency of the financial system as promised by tokenisation, while preserving monetary policy effectiveness, financial stability and monetary sovereignty.
